Thanks to the second place in the mixed relay in Villars sur Ollon, Alba De Silvestro and Michele Boscacci win the World Cup

VILLARS SUR OLLON (SWITZERLAND) – Alba De Silvestro scores a double. After winning the World Cup in the individual event, she also takes the mixed relay title with her husband Michele Boscacci. Thanks to the second place achieved on the snow of Villars sur Ollon, Switzerland, the Italian couple indeed outshines their opponents and brings the total to three Italian World Cups this season, including Giulia Murada‘s in the Overall.

A hard-fought race from the start for the home couple in Valtellina, with the Belluno champion in a continuous head-to-head with the Spaniard Oriol Cardona Coll, racing with Ana Alonso Rodriguez, who ultimately wins after 33’55″6 of racing. Right behind is Boscacci, crossing the finish line at 12″8 ahead of the French team made up of Celia Perillat Pessey and Thibault Anselmet, who finish third at 18″1.

Out of the podium, Austria’s Johanna Hiemer and Paul Verbnjak are in fourth place at 40″8, with Germany and Switzerland in fifth and sixth place. This last result allows the Italians to take home the World Cup in their category, bringing Italy to 336 points, ahead of the Swiss and the Germans.

A success achieved thanks to the second place in the debut race in the United States, in Val Martello, and in the final act in Villars, as well as the fifth place marked in the Pyrenees at Boi Taull.
